Using Angello in Adobe Photoshop/Illustrator
Adobe Creative Cloud is a powerful suite of design tools that offers advanced typography features. Here’s how to use Angello in Photoshop and Illustrator:
- Install the Angello font on your computer (make sure it’s in a compatible format, such as OTF or TTF).
- Open Photoshop or Illustrator and select the text tool.
- Choose the Angello font from the font dropdown menu and adjust the font size, color, and other settings to your liking.
- To access OpenType features, such as glyphs and stylistic alternates, click on the “Window” menu and select “Glyphs” or “OpenType.”
